According to reports, there are currently no indications that former WWE owner Vince McMahon will be in attendance at this weekend's WWE Hall of Fame ceremony in Las Vegas. McMahon, who built WrestleMania into one of the biggest entertainment events in the world, has been largely absent from the company since selling it and being ousted several years ago. This year's Hall of Fame class includes Stephanie McMahon, AJ Styles, Demolition, Sid Vicious, Bad News Brown, and Dennis Rodman.

The details

After selling WWE to TKO and being ousted from the company, Vince McMahon has maintained a low profile and has not been involved with the organization in any official capacity. This weekend's Hall of Fame ceremony, which will see the induction of his daughter Stephanie as well as several other notable names, is not expected to include an appearance by the former WWE chairman and CEO.
